If the contract of the contract teacher is terminated by himself or his institution, the person cannot work as a contract again after at least one year. As a matter of fact, when evaluated according to various factors, appointments can be made without a one-year waiting period.

Contract Teacher Salaries 2023

Contracted teacher salaries are also among those who are curious in 2023. Persons who are teaching graduates can work as a contracted teacher during the period when they are not appointed by the state.

It is known that they work for a lower wage as well as the primary teachers assigned by the institution. With the 2023 minimum wage increase, the current salaries of contract teachers are as follows:

CONTRACTUAL TEACHER SALARY CURRENT 2023
Lowest contract teacher salary 8.600 TL
Average contract teacher salary 11.200 TL
Highest contract teacher salary 13.900 TL

Although the current salary rates are as we have mentioned, they may differ. In particular, the place of work, experience and similar factors directly affect the amount of salaries.

Can Contracted Personnel Resign Anytime?

For those wondering if contract personnel can resign at any time, the answer will be yes. Resignation is a right given to civil servants with Law No. 657. As a matter of fact, it should be known that resignation is not possible for the personnel who serve under contract within the scope of 4B. The contract of the personnel working within the scope of 4B can only be terminated by the institution. It is not possible otherwise.
